#47742d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47742d is composed of 27.8% red, 45.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#47742d color hex could be obtained by blending #8ee85a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#47742d color description : Dark moderate green.
#47742d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47742d has RGB values of R:71, G:116,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4682797.

Shades and Tints of #47742d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#47742d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f554c is the less saturated color, while #3b9f02 is the most saturated one.
